We neurotic types clean litter boxes daily. If that’s too much for you, litter boxes should be scooped out at least every other day. Of course, this depends on how many cats you have. The more cats you have, the more frequently the boxes should be scooped out. While it’s a dirty job, it really should be done for the best interest of your cat (s).

Do my cats need two litter boxes?
“The rule of thumb is one litter box per cat, plus one extra,” Galaxy says. As a cat foster mom, I recommend that new adopters have at least 1.5 litter boxes per cat. So if you have one cat, you need two litter boxes; two cats, three litter boxes. Some cats just don’t like sharing litter boxes, and this ratio lets each cat claim his own.

Are enclosed litter boxes bad for cats?
Enclosed litter boxes are dark, hold in smells, and are not inviting for a cat to eliminate inside of. These qualities make a cat less likely to want to use a litter box and instead encourages them to go outside the box . What do cats like in their litter boxes?
Most cats like a shallow bed of litter. Provide one to two inches of litter rather than three to four inches. Most cats prefer clumping, unscented litter. Your cat may prefer the type of litter she used as a kitten. Most cats don’t like box liners or lids on their boxes. Cats like their litter boxes located in a quiet but not “cornered” location.
